            The real problem is that Shane's urine wasn't even tested for EPO....at all. If they tested his urine for more than just stock standard roids he may never have gotten away with it.

            As for the other stuff....THG was not detecable in blood or urine at the time shane was taking it.

            WADA standards are what boxing needs.

              I am unhappy with Floyd's methods and find them suspect BUT I agree that testing needs to tightened to the full extent of science. We are not dealing with a race or a game but a sport where dominance can cause lifelong injury or even death in an opponant.
              All commissions need to ensure that ALL fighters fight on a clean, level playing field.

              I don't understand why samples are not kept secure for a longer period and tested with superior technology 5 years hence. Anything that was hidden would now be common knowledge and this would act as a deterrent. Would you cheat now if you were 99% certain you'd be exposed and prosecuted as a cheat a few years down the line?
